Here's some info for anyone who is interested in this feature or has already customized their screen. I think it's a pretty cool way to personalize your LS and is nice touch upon start up and to display an image while driving when using the data in the window isn't a necessity.

***I will update this initial post with any relevant info. so we can keep it in one place. I got some info. over on the GS thread but given the 13+ have a slightly bigger screen and different details I wanted to share it here.

First off what the instructions don't say is you must use a USB memory stick that is formatted from a PC. The Lexus HD will not recognize anything formatted on a Mac. I formatted mine with FAT32. I also only used 2 folders named EXACTLY "StartupImage" and "DisplayoffImage". It is case sensitive. You can only load 3 images (.jpg / .jpeg file format) per folder so only load the 3 / 6 total. Simply insert this correctly formatted USB drive into the port in your center console and open the menu on the main screen. Go to General Settings and then select "Customize Startup Image" on the second page down. Select "transfer" then choose your favorite image. In my experience the start up image will only flash for a second upon start up after the Lexus & "L" logo and this lasts a total of 5 seconds on every start up.The Display Off Image will be prominently displayed whenever you choose to have the display off (when you're not using navigation etc.) The image will only populate in the center of the display so you may choose to create any size image but keep in mind you may or may not see black bars at the top and bottom of your image depending on the image created and selected.

The Lexus startup sequence is a movie not an image (visible on "Customize startup image" screen). It seems the only way would be to trick the system to play an uploaded movie file or to animate the JPEG image. There may be a way to animate a JPEG - check out this link (http://css.spritegen.com). I looked into JPEG animation and motion JPEGs but no luck. Those tricks work to animate a jpeg file in a web browser but not in a image viewer like the Lexus display. On the startup Image customizing screen, there are Lexus default movies on the right side. One can select which one plays on start up.
